+ def test_Define(self):
+ """Test SConf.Define()
+ """
+ self._resetSConfState()
+ sconf = self.SConf.SConf(self.scons_env,
+ conf_dir=self.test.workpath('config.tests'),
+ log_file=self.test.workpath('config.log'),
+ config_h = self.test.workpath('config.h'))
+ try:
+ # XXX: we test the generated config.h string. This is not so good,
+ # ideally, we would like to test if the generated file included in
+ # a test program does what we want.
+
+ # Test defining one symbol wo value
+ sconf.config_h_text = ''
+ sconf.Define('YOP')
+ assert sconf.config_h_text == '#define YOP\n'
+
+ # Test defining one symbol with integer value
+ sconf.config_h_text = ''
+ sconf.Define('YOP', 1)
+ assert sconf.config_h_text == '#define YOP 1\n'
+
+ # Test defining one symbol with string value
+ sconf.config_h_text = ''
+ sconf.Define('YOP', '"YIP"')
+ assert sconf.config_h_text == '#define YOP "YIP"\n'
+
+ # Test defining one symbol with string value
+ sconf.config_h_text = ''
+ sconf.Define('YOP', "YIP")
+ assert sconf.config_h_text == '#define YOP YIP\n'
+
+ finally:
+ sconf.Finish()

+ def test_CheckDeclaration(self):
+ """Test SConf.CheckDeclaration()
+ """
+ self._resetSConfState()
+ sconf = self.SConf.SConf(self.scons_env,
+ conf_dir=self.test.workpath('config.tests'),
+ log_file=self.test.workpath('config.log'))
+ try:
+ # In ANSI C, malloc should be available in stdlib
+ r = sconf.CheckDeclaration('malloc', includes = "#include <stdlib.h>")
+ assert r, "malloc not declared ??"
+ # For C++, __cplusplus should be declared
+ r = sconf.CheckDeclaration('__cplusplus', language = 'C++')
+ assert r, "__cplusplus not declared in C++ ??"
+ r = sconf.CheckDeclaration('__cplusplus', language = 'C')
+ assert not r, "__cplusplus declared in C ??"
+ finally:
+ sconf.Finish()
